Fu Shek Financial Holdings Expects Net Profit to Rise to HK$6.2 Million for First Half of 2025

Fu Shek Financial Holdings Limited has issued a positive profit alert, announcing that it expects to record a net profit of approximately HK$6.2 million for the six months ended 30 September 2025. This represents an increase compared to a net profit of approximately HK$1.5 million for the same period in 2024. The Board attributed the increase in net profit mainly to higher commission and brokerage income on securities dealing, increased handling and other fee income, and a rise in interest income from margin financing services. The interim results are based on unaudited consolidated management accounts and have not yet been reviewed by the Company's auditors or confirmed by the audit committee. The final interim results announcement is scheduled for 27 November 2025. Shareholders and potential investors are advised to exercise caution when dealing in the shares of the Company.
